Episode Description
Bulent Altan started his career at SpaceX in 2004, fresh out of Bob Twiggs' CubeSat lab at Stanford, joining the small team working on Falcon 1. He stayed long enough to put his technical fingerprints on every major SpaceX development. Now he's the founding partner at Alpine Space Ventures, a venture capital fund making hands-on investments in European space startups. Even as a VC, he "gets to do engineering every day."
